What Is a Genet Cat?

Genet Cat Hunting
Genet Cat Hunting

The genet, often called a genet cat, is a small African carnivore belonging to the Viverridae family, which includes civets. Despite its appearance, it is not a domestic cat.

Key characteristics:

  • Slender, agile body

  • Long, ringed tail

  • Spotted or banded coat

  • Strictly nocturnal behavior

  • Excellent vision and hearing

Genets are widespread across sub-Saharan Africa and thrive in savannah, woodland, and forest edge environments.

Is Genet Cat Hunting Legal?

Yes. Genet cat hunting is legal in Cameroon when conducted under the country’s regulated safari hunting system.

Important legal facts:

  • Genets are not endangered

  • They are classified as small game

  • Hunting is allowed only inside licensed hunting concessions

  • Foreign hunters must hunt with registered outfitters and professional hunters

Unlicensed or independent hunting is illegal and strictly prohibited.

Genet Cat Hunting Season in Cameroon

The official hunting season in Cameroon runs from:

Mid-December to mid-April

This period offers:

  • Dry conditions

  • Excellent night visibility

  • High genet activity levels

  • Stable travel logistics

Exact dates may vary slightly by concession, but all hunts operate within this window.

How Genet Cat Hunting Is Conducted

Genets are nocturnal, so all hunting is done at night.

Typical methods include:

  • Slow vehicle spotlighting

  • Tracking along trails and clearings

  • Opportunistic encounters during night plains game hunts

Hunting is done under the guidance of a licensed professional hunter, ensuring proper species identification and ethical shot placement.

This is a precision hunt, not volume shooting.

Pricing Plans for Genet Cat Hunting in Cameroon

Genet cat hunting is generally included in Cameroon plains game safari packages rather than sold as a standalone hunt.

Typical Safari Pricing

6-Day Plains Game Safari (1 Hunter):

  • Price range: $12,000 to $13,500

  • Includes accommodation, guiding, meals, transport, and hunting services

6-Day Plains Game Safari (2 Hunters):

  • Price range: $17,500 to $19,000

  • Shared professional hunter and logistics

Genet Trophy Fees

  • Often included or priced as a low-cost small game species

  • Exact fees depend on concession and outfitter

Prices vary based on:

  • Number of hunters

  • Concession location

  • Species list

  • Level of accommodation
